Responsibilities

Properly report financial statements in accordance with GAAP to stakeholders

- Prepare financial statements with the assistance of the Accounting Manager for external stakeholders and internal teams.

- Ensure all transactions are properly accounted under GAAP and technical matters are properly documented in accounting memos.

- Maintain and enhance the company’s ERP system (Intacct)

- Build, document and test internal controls

Ensure smooth financial operations

- Ensure the procure-to-pay process runs smooth; vendors are paid promptly, controls are followed, cash is safeguarded and reporting is accurate.

- Manage the payroll process with the Accounting Manager and HR team

- Ensure cash collection is accurate and complete

Manage and grow the team

- The role will manage the Accounting Manager and future accounting heads. ActiveCampaign prides itself on fostering a workplace where employees can grow. As leader of the accounting team, the Controller will be responsible for the success of the rest of his / her team

Own the relationship with outside accounting teams

- ActiveCampaign has annual financial audits by a Big4 Accounting firm. In addition, we have relationships with other major firms for tax, systems, compliance and regulatory purposes. This role will manage these relationships.

Responsible for proper tax accounting

- While ActiveCampaign is a limited liability company it still faces complex tax matters including transfer pricing, international, R&D tax credits, IL EDGE tax credits, and sales tax. This role will be responsible for managing and mitigating our tax liability.

- Responsible for managing the company’s sales tax exposure.

What your day could consist of:

  • Liaise with external audit firm to review technical accounting matter
  • Review and approve payroll
  • Create financial statements for external parties
  • Determine the best transfer pricing arrangement for new international entities and build out international treasury functions

What is needed:

  • Bachelor's degree in Accounting or Finance
  • 3+ years in a Big 4 accounting firm
  • CPA certification required
  • Experience with SaaS business model and in particular subscription-based revenue recognition
  • Prior people management experience preferred
  • Experience with complex technical accounting matters
  • Strong analytical and problem solving skills
